How to calculate 10% of 5,000
To find a percentage of a number, multiply the number by the percentage as a decimal. 10% written as a decimal is 0.1, so the calculation is:
10 / 100 × 5,000 = 0.1 × 5,000 = 500
The word "percent" literally means "per hundred" — 10% is 10 parts out of every 100. So 10% of 5,000 asks: if 5,000 is split into 100 equal parts of 50, how much is 10 of those parts? 500.

Frequently asked questions
How do I calculate 10% of 5,000 by hand?
Convert the percentage to a decimal and multiply: 10% = 0.1, so 0.1 × 5,000 = 500. A mental shortcut: find 10% first (divide by 10 → 500), then scale from there.
500 is what percent of 5,000?
500 is exactly 10% of 5,000 — that's the reverse of this calculation: (part ÷ whole) × 100 = (500 ÷ 5,000) × 100 = 10%.
Why do percentages matter so much in daily life?
Percentages appear in discounts, taxes, tips, interest rates, test scores and statistics. Because they express proportions relative to a whole, they let you compare values of completely different sizes on equal footing.
